Displaying 5 results from an estimated 5 matches for "cairo_show_page".
2007 Sep 13
0
test/swfdec-extract.c
...;extents.y0 / SWFDEC_TWIPS_SCALE_FACTOR));
- cairo_scale (cr, 1 / SWFDEC_TWIPS_SCALE_FACTOR, 1 / SWFDEC_TWIPS_SCALE_FACTOR);
+ cairo_scale (cr, 1.0 / SWFDEC_TWIPS_SCALE_FACTOR, 1.0 / SWFDEC_TWIPS_SCALE_FACTOR);
swfdec_graphic_render (graphic, cr, &trans, &graphic->extents, TRUE);
cairo_show_page (cr);
cairo_destroy (cr);
2010 Jul 20
1
Building rattle on Solaris 10u7 X86
...use: window
"cairoDevice.c", line 78: improper member use: window
"cairoDevice.c", line 80: undefined struct/union member: cr
"cairoDevice.c", line 81: undefined struct/union member: cr_custom
"cairoDevice.c", line 82: warning: implicit function declaration:
cairo_show_page
"cairoDevice.c", line 82: improper member use: cr
"cairoDevice.c", line 83: warning: implicit function declaration:
cairo_restore
"cairoDevice.c", line 83: improper member use: cr
"cairoDevice.c", line 84: warning: implicit function declaration:
cairo_destroy...
2007 Aug 29
0
15 commits - libswfdec/swfdec_as_strings.c libswfdec/swfdec_initialize.as libswfdec/swfdec_initialize.h libswfdec/swfdec_movie.c libswfdec/swfdec_movie.h libswfdec/swfdec_sprite.c libswfdec/swfdec_sprite_movie.c libswfdec/swfdec_system_as.c
...- if (w == 0 || h == 0) {
- return;
- }
- surface = cairo_svg_surface_create (
- gtk_file_chooser_get_filename (GTK_FILE_CHOOSER (dialog)),
- w, h);
- cr = cairo_create (surface);
- cairo_surface_destroy (surface);
- swfdec_player_render (player, cr, 0.0, 0.0, 0.0, 0.0);
- cairo_show_page (cr);
- cairo_destroy (cr);
- }
- gtk_widget_destroy (dialog);
-}
-#endif /* CAIRO_HAS_SVG_SURFACE */
-
-static void
-step_clicked_cb (GtkButton *button, SwfdecPlayerManager *manager)
-{
- swfdec_player_manager_iterate (manager);
-}
-
-static void
-step_disable_cb (SwfdecPlayerManager *manage...
2008 Jan 07
0
12 commits - configure.ac doc/swfdec.types Makefile.am test/crashfinder.c test/dump.c test/Makefile.am test/swfdec-extract.c test/swfdec_out.c test/swfdec_out.h test/swfedit.c test/swfedit_file.c test/swfedit_file.h test/swfedit_list.c test/swfedit_list.h
..., - floor (graphic->extents.x0 / SWFDEC_TWIPS_SCALE_FACTOR),
- - floor (graphic->extents.y0 / SWFDEC_TWIPS_SCALE_FACTOR));
- cairo_scale (cr, 1.0 / SWFDEC_TWIPS_SCALE_FACTOR, 1.0 / SWFDEC_TWIPS_SCALE_FACTOR);
- swfdec_graphic_render (graphic, cr, &trans, &graphic->extents);
- cairo_show_page (cr);
- cairo_destroy (cr);
- return surface_destroy_for_type (surface, filename);
-}
-
-static gboolean
-export_image (SwfdecImage *image, const char *filename)
-{
- cairo_surface_t *surface = swfdec_image_create_surface (image);
-
- if (surface == NULL)
- return FALSE;
- return surface_de...
2007 Mar 27
0
15 commits - configure.ac doc/Makefile.am doc/swfdec-docs.sgml doc/swfdec-sections.txt doc/swfdec.types libswfdec-gtk/.gitignore libswfdec-gtk/Makefile.am libswfdec-gtk/swfdec-gtk.h libswfdec-gtk/swfdec_gtk_player.c libswfdec-gtk/swfdec_gtk_player.h
...}
+ cairo_scale (cr, priv->real_scale, priv->real_scale);
+ swfdec_player_render (priv->player, cr,
+ event->area.x / priv->real_scale, event->area.y / priv->real_scale,
+ event->area.width / priv->real_scale, event->area.height / priv->real_scale);
+ cairo_show_page (cr);
+ cairo_destroy (cr);
+
+ if (surface) {
+ cairo_t *crw = gdk_cairo_create (gtkwidget->window);
+ cairo_set_source_surface (crw, surface, event->area.x, event->area.y);
+ cairo_paint (crw);
+ cairo_destroy (crw);
+ cairo_surface_destroy (surface);
+ }
+
+ return FA...